What is the science behind Pink or Blue®?
Recent scientific discovery has found that there is fetal
DNA in an expectant mother's blood. In a natural process,
fetal cells die and pass into the mother's bloodstream. As
these cells break down, their DNA is released into the mother's
own circulatory system. The cells decompose and free DNA is
released into the mother's bloodstream. Using the mother's
DNA sample, we can determine if there is Y-specific chromosomal
DNA. If we detect Y-specific chromosomal DNA, the fetus is
male. If there is no Y-specific chromosomal DNA, the fetus
is a female. For more information, see Science Science
Behind Pink or Blue®.

Other factors that could affect the accuracy rate of Pink or Blue® include:
- Not following the directions carefully
- Not providing enough blood sample
- Contaminating the sample with male DNA
It is VERY IMPORTANT that all instructions are followed correctly after receiving the Pink or Blue® Kit. MALES SHOULD NOT OPEN THE KIT OR HANDLE ANY KIT CONTENTS AT ANY TIME. Bathrooms, sinks, counter surfaces, and hand-towels shared between male and female household members are contaminated with male DNA. Please cover sinks, and counters with clean paper towels, or wax paper or aluminum foil before collection starts. Please wash hands thoroughly before sample collection. Dry your hands using only clean and unused paper towels, NOT shared cloth towels. We test the white portion of the customer’s DNA collection card, as a negative control. The white portion of the DNA collection card is tested for the presence of Y-chromosomal DNA. If any signal is detected, the sample is contaminated, and no result can be released.

Can I use Pink or Blue® if I have a multiple birth pregnancy?
Yes. You may use Pink or Blue® if you are carrying more than one fetus. Pink or Blue® will not determine the number of boys or girls you are expecting. Pink or Blue® only detects the presence or absence of DNA from the Y-chromosome, the test will only tell you if you're expecting at least one boy or only girls.

Why is Pink or Blue® not available in China or India?
Due to the high incidence of gender selection in China and India, it is our policy not to service these countries. No exceptions can be made.
Why is Pink or Blue® not available in New York?
New York State regulations regarding DNA-based tests are quite stringent. All DNA-based tests must be ordered by the physician, and the laboratory performing the tests must obtain clearance from the state. Due to these requirements, Pink or Blue® is not available to NY residents at this time.
